11 PROFINET IO
11.1 Basics
General information PROFINET is an open Industrial Ethernet standard of PROFIBUS & PROF-
INET International (PI) for the automation system. PROFINET is standardized
in IEC 61158.
PROFINET uses TCP/IP and IT standards and supplements the PROFIBUS
technology for applications in which fast data communication is required in
combination with industrial IT functions.
There are 2 PROFINET functional classes:
PROFINET IO (the class used in the bus node art. no. 57106)
PROFINET CBA
These classes can be realized in 3 performance levels:
TCP/IP communication
RT communication (the level used in the bus node art. no. 57106)
IRT communication
PROFINET IO PROFINET IO describes an I/O data view of decentralized periphery. It de-
scribes the entire data exchange between the IO controller and IO device. The
planning of PROFINET IO is based on PROFIBUS. PROFINET IO includes
the real-time concept (RT).
A provider-consumer model is used in PROFINET IO. It supports the applica-
tion relations (AR = Application Relation) between nodes with equal access
rights on the Ethernet. In this case the provider sends its data without request
of the communication partner. Beside process data exchange it also supports
the functions for parameterization and diagnosis.
PROFINET CBA PROFINET CBA stands for Component Based Automation.
The purpose of this component model is the communication between au-
tonomously working control units.
It allows a modular design of complex systems with the help of distributed
intelligence by means of a graphic configuration of the communication be-
tween intelligent modules.
TCP/IP communication This is an open communication via Ethernet TCP/IP which does not take place
mandatorily in real time.
RT communication RT stands for Real-Time.
The RT communication is the basis for the data exchange on PROFINET
IO.
RT data are handled with higher priority.
IRT communication IRT stands for Isochronous Real-T
ime.
During the IRT communication, the start of the bus cycle is exactly timed,
i.e., with a maximum permissible deviation and with constant synchroniza-
tion. This guarantees time-controlled and isochronous transfer of data.
Sync telegrams from a Sync master in the network are used for synchro-
nization.
